- Foundation Crack Repair - needed when visible cracks develop in the foundation walls or floors due to settling or shifting.
- Foundation Underpinning - required when the existing foundation no longer supports the structure properly because of soil movement or deterioration.
- Basement Wall Stabilization - necessary if basement walls bow, crack, or lean as a result of hydrostatic pressure or soil pressure.
- Pier and Beam Foundation Repair - essential when the support piers or beams show signs of movement, sagging, or damage affecting the stability of the structure.
- Concrete Slab Repair - needed when uneven or cracked slabs threaten the integrity of floors or pose safety hazards in residential or commercial buildings.
Foundation repair services involve assessing and restoring the structural stability of a building’s foundation. This process typically includes identifying issues such as cracks, uneven settling, or shifting that compromise the integrity of the structure. Once problems are diagnosed, contractors may employ a variety of techniques such as piering, underpinning, or slab stabilization to reinforce and level the foundation. These services aim to prevent further damage, improve safety, and maintain the property's value over time.
Many foundation issues stem from soil movement, moisture fluctuations, or poor initial construction, leading to problems like cracked walls, uneven floors, or sticking doors and windows. Foundation Repair Costs - The typical cost range for foundation repair services varies from $2,000 to $7,000, depending on the extent of damage. Minor repairs, such as crack sealing, may be closer to $2,000, while extensive underpinning can exceed $7,000.
Factors Influencing Cost - Costs can fluctuate based on the foundation type, size, and severity of issues. For example, a small basement crack repair might be around $1,500, whereas major foundation stabilization could reach $10,000 or more.
Service Scope - Foundation repair services often include assessments, excavation, and reinforcement. The average project in Palatine, IL, might range from $3,000 for basic repairs to over $15,000 for comprehensive solutions.
Additional Expenses - Extra costs may arise from necessary permits, soil stabilization, or waterproofing, which can add a few hundred to several thousand dollars to the total. Local pros can provide detailed estimates based on specific need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s of foundation issues? Signs may include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sloping surfaces, and doors or windows that stick or don’t close properly.
How long does foundation repair typically take? The duration varies depending on the extent of the damage, but most repairs can be completed within a few days to a week.
Are foundation repairs necessary for minor cracks? It’s advisable to have a professional evaluate minor cracks to determine if they indicate a larger problem requiring repair.
What types of foundation repair methods are available? Common methods include underpinning, pier and beam adjustments, and slab stabilization, depending on the foundation type and issue.
How can I prevent future foundation problems? Proper drainage, maintaining soil stability, and addressing any early signs of settling can help reduce the risk of future issues.
